Finally created my own set of decals. But I have some trouble getting them to show up on the aircraft.

 

[Decal010]

MeshName=fuselage_front

DecalLevel=0

DecalFacing=RIGHT

FilenameFormat=F-104G\RDAFF-104GESK723\d\NUM

Position=4.8,-0.070

Rotation=0.0

Scale=2.0

DecalMaxLOD=3

 

my decals are named NUM000,NUM001 etc. according to the numberlist. If I call out a specific decal it shows.

 

What are I doing wrong??

Posted
decal level for numbers is 2, not 0. :biggrin:

Level 0 is for nationality markings - INSIGNIA and FINFLASH will get you the markings that correspond to the nationality settings, either in the data.ini or the TextureSet.ini.

 

Level 1 is for technical markings such as ejection seat triangles, intake markings, etc.

Posted

Close, but not entirely true:

0 = Nation ID

1 = Squadron ID

2 = Aircraft Number

3 = Kill Number

 

(from TW's Decal Tutorial)

 

If you want a decal to show up always (not bound to AC number, etc.) use a decal with level 2 and no number for the decal - if the program doesn't find one with the correct number (like num001) it searches for the basic one (like num)!
